Buying Guide for the Best Resin For Jewelry

Choosing the right resin for jewelry making is crucial to ensure that your creations are durable, beautiful, and safe to wear. Resin is a versatile material that can be used to create a wide variety of jewelry pieces, from pendants and earrings to rings and bracelets. When selecting resin, it's important to consider several key specifications to ensure you get the best results for your projects. Understanding these specifications will help you make an informed decision and achieve the desired outcome for your jewelry pieces.
Curing TimeCuring time refers to the amount of time it takes for the resin to harden completely. This is important because it affects how long you need to wait before you can handle or wear your jewelry. Resins with shorter curing times (e.g., 24 hours) are great for quick projects, while those with longer curing times (e.g., 48-72 hours) may offer better durability and clarity. Choose a curing time that fits your project timeline and patience level.
ViscosityViscosity is the thickness of the resin in its liquid state. Low-viscosity resins are thinner and flow more easily, making them ideal for intricate molds and detailed work. High-viscosity resins are thicker and better suited for larger molds or projects where you want to avoid excessive spreading. Consider the complexity of your jewelry designs when choosing the viscosity of your resin.
UV ResistanceUV resistance indicates how well the resin can withstand exposure to sunlight without yellowing or degrading. This is important for jewelry that will be worn outdoors or exposed to sunlight regularly. Resins with high UV resistance will maintain their clarity and appearance over time. If your jewelry is intended for frequent outdoor use, opt for a resin with strong UV resistance.
ClarityClarity refers to how clear and transparent the resin is once it has cured. High-clarity resins are essential for projects where you want to showcase embedded objects or achieve a glass-like finish. If your jewelry designs involve embedding items like flowers, glitter, or other decorative elements, choose a resin with excellent clarity to ensure these details are visible and vibrant.
HardnessHardness measures how durable and scratch-resistant the cured resin will be. This is important for ensuring that your jewelry can withstand daily wear and tear. Resins with higher hardness ratings are more durable and less likely to scratch or dent. For jewelry that will be worn frequently, select a resin with a high hardness rating to ensure longevity.
Mixing RatioThe mixing ratio is the proportion of resin to hardener that must be combined to achieve proper curing. This is important because incorrect mixing can result in incomplete curing or a sticky finish. Some resins have a simple 1:1 ratio, while others may require more precise measurements. Choose a resin with a mixing ratio that you find easy to work with and follow the instructions carefully to ensure the best results.
SafetySafety refers to the potential health risks associated with using the resin. Some resins emit strong fumes or contain chemicals that can be harmful if inhaled or if they come into contact with skin. It's important to choose a resin that is labeled as non-toxic and to work in a well-ventilated area, wearing protective gear such as gloves and masks. Prioritize safety, especially if you are sensitive to chemicals or plan to work with resin frequently.
